Problems solved by technology

In this case, the number of executions specified by the manufacturer of the robotic cleaner is often less than necessary for the size of the room, resulting in unsatisfactory cleaning of the room and areas that were not cleaned
Otherwise, if the number of executions specified by the manufacturer greatly exceeds the appropriate number of executions, there will be no areas that are not cleaned, but the number of areas that are repeatedly cleaned will increase, resulting in an inevitable decrease in the battery life of the robot cleaner
[0007] In addition, if the area being cleaned is complex, there will also be areas that are not cleaned
Specifically, if the robot cleaner rotates on the corner portion adjacent to the wall, it is difficult for the conventional robot cleaner to effectively clean the corner portion

Abstract

A robot cleaner and a method of controlling the same are disclosed. The robot cleaner cleans a given cleaning area simultaneously while moving in the cleaning area. The method includes detecting whether an obstacle exists in a traveling path of the robot cleaner, determining whether the detected obstacle is an edge when the obstacle is detected, cleaning a predetermined area centering around the edge when the detected obstacle is determined to be the edge, and determining whether the cleaning area is completely cleaned on the basis of information of the detected edge while cleaning the predetermined area.

Description

technical field [0001] The present invention relates to a robot cleaner that moves in a specific area to be cleaned by the robot cleaner to clean the specific area, and more particularly, relates to a method of using edge information of a target area to determine a target area. A robot cleaner indicating whether an area is completely cleaned and a method for controlling the robot cleaner. Background technique [0002] Generally, the robot cleaner moves in a target area to be cleaned by the robot cleaner without receiving a user's command, and absorbs dust or impurities from the ground of the target area, thereby cleaning the target area. The robot cleaner uses its sensors to determine its distance to obstacles (such as furniture, office supplies, or walls) contained in the target area, and based on the determined distance, moves in the target area without colliding with the obstacles, thereby cleaning target area.
